Discover a buzzing new hobby: Beekeeping 101 will begin March 7 at Wise Nature Center in Beaver Creek Reserve. It costs $40 for members and $45 for nonmembers, a hands-on chance to connect with nature — see date, location, and cost.
A day of eco discovery: Eau Claire Earth Fest will be at The Sonnentag on April 18 with sustainability booths, a repair fair, free workshops, a Landmark Conservancy guided hike, and UW-Eau Claire student research — get all the details.
Students take center stage: Eau Claire North’s Northern Irish were crowned Grand Champions at Medford’s Red White Spotlight, taking best vocals, choreography, and costumes. The final performance is tomorrow, March 5, at the school — see final performance details.

🐶 Come When Called @ emBARK | Thursday (3/5) at 7:30 PM – Tired of the 6am bathrobe parade, coffee in hand, yelling your dog’s name while pretending the cul-de-sac is asleep? This four-week Come When Called class tunes up recall with real-world distractions, as a refresher or a first step, so your pup actually comes back.
🍀 Shamrock Shuffle 5K Run/Walk 2026 @ McPhee Athletic Training Center | Saturday (3/7) at 9:00 AM – Take a spin with the Shamrock Shuffle, a 5K-ish run-walk that starts and ends at UWEC’s McPhee, drops infamous Garfield Hill, cruises the footbridge, and hugs the Chippewa. Chase the clock or stroll with the stroller, your call, bring layers and a sense of humor.
🌈 3rd Annual End of the Rainbow Craft & Vendor Fair @ Best Western Plus Eau Claire Conference Center | Saturday (3/7) at 10:00 AM – The 3rd Annual End of the Rainbow Craft & Vendor Fair takes over the Best Western Plus Eau Claire Conference Center, with local makers, handmade finds, and zero mall chaos. Come browse, chat with neighbors, and snag gifts you’ll swear are for others, then keep.
🌿 Plant Bingo! @ Green Oasis | Saturday (3/7) at 10:00 AM – Whether you kill succulents or name your pothos like a grandchild, classic bingo with a leafy payout awaits. Thirty-five bucks gets you a card and a full session, extra cards are five, two sessions, and every round sends someone home with a plant. ☘ How to Catch a Leprechaun @ Hope Lutheran Church | Saturday (3/7) at 10:30 AM – Kid-and-caregiver fun is turning recycled odds and ends into leprechaun traps, decorating an Irish hat to wear home, storytelling, and games. Thirty bucks covers you both, light snacks and drinks included, and just enough glitter to find in the car next week.
🌳 Genealogy for Kids @ Chippewa Valley Museum | Saturday (3/7) at 1:00 PM – Let your 8 to 12-year-old trade screen time for family sleuthing with Genealogy for Kids, where Sara Thielen turns grandma’s stories into primary sources, and scribbles into a real family tree. Bring an adult accomplice. $5 per child, one adult free, only 24 spots.
🎻 Bluegrass Gospel Jam @ Chippewa Valley Seventh-day Adventist Church | Saturday (3/7) at 6:00 PM – Bluegrass Gospel Jam is gathering the pickers and the toe tappers for an old-school singalong with banjos, fiddles, and plenty of harmony. Dust off that mandolin you only play at Christmas, or just bring your ears, and soak up some foot-stomping, soul-lifting tunes.
